Understanding Google vs. Bing SEO

Before diving into AI tools and strategies, let’s first understand the key differences between Google and Bing:

Google:

  • Prioritizes natural language processing and semantic search.
  • Emphasizes E-E-A-T (Experience, Expertise, Authoritativeness, and Trustworthiness).
  • Gives weight to backlinks from authoritative domains.
  • Mobile-first and Core Web Vitals are major ranking signals.
  • Google understands user intent and long-tail keywords better.

Bing:

  • Values exact match keywords more than Google.
  • Gives higher preference to meta tags and schema markup.
  • Ranks older, authoritative domains better.
  • Prefers multimedia content like images and videos.
  • Bing integrates well with social signals from platforms like Facebook, LinkedIn, and Twitter.

Part 1: Using AI for Google SEO

1. AI for Semantic Keyword Research

Google’s RankBrain and BERT focus heavily on search intent. AI tools like SurferSEO and Frase.io use machine learning to understand keyword clusters and related queries. When optimizing for Google:

  • Target long-tail keywords and their variations.
  • Use AI to identify LSI keywords (Latent Semantic Indexing).
  • Focus on building topic authority with pillar pages and content clusters.

2. AI-Powered Content Creation

Tools like Jasper AI and Copy.ai can generate human-like content tailored to Google's preferences. Ensure that your content:

  • Answers the query clearly and comprehensively.
  • Includes structured headings with relevant keywords.
  • Uses natural language and avoids keyword stuffing.

3. AI-Driven On-Page Optimization

Use Page Optimizer Pro or SurferSEO to:

  • Analyze top-ranking pages.
  • Optimize keyword density.
  • Improve internal linking.

4. Predictive Analytics and User Behavior

Google rewards websites that offer a great user experience. Use AI tools like Hotjar and Google Analytics 4 (GA4) to:

  • Analyze user sessions.
  • Identify pages with high bounce rates.
  • A/B test content using AI suggestions.

5. AI-Based Voice Search Optimization

With the rise of voice assistants, use AI tools to optimize content for voice search:

  • Target conversational queries.
  • Use FAQ schema to answer common questions.

Part 2: Using AI for Bing SEO

1. AI for Exact Match Keyword Strategy

Bing still gives weight to exact match keywords. Use AI keyword tools like SEMrush and Ubersuggest to:

  • Find high-volume exact match keywords.
  • Analyze competitors' keywords ranking on Bing.

2. Schema Markup and Meta Tags

Bing relies heavily on metadata. Use AI plugins like Rank Math or Yoast SEO Premium to:

  • Optimize title tags and meta descriptions with primary keywords.
  • Add comprehensive schema markup (events, reviews, products).

3. AI-Powered Image and Video SEO

Use tools like Canva AI, Runway ML, and Lumen5 to:

  • Create unique visuals and videos.
  • Compress and tag images with descriptive filenames and alt text.
  • Use Bing Image Creator to generate relevant visuals.

4. AI for Social Signal Integration

Use tools like Buffer AI, Publer, and SocialBee to optimize your content across multiple platforms and increase social engagement.

  • Share content on LinkedIn, Facebook, and Twitter to get more visibility on Bing.
  • Monitor and boost posts that generate more clicks.

5. AI for Bing Webmaster Tools Optimization

Use Bing Webmaster Tools Insights and pair it with AI dashboards (like Zoho Analytics or Databox) to:

  • Track keyword movement.
  • Identify crawl issues.
  • Optimize pages based on Bing-specific signals.
